Output 83c24de6b1f146ae414677ff2df51aaa4fed4e83a1e982d320f6aa942a18f8ee:0

value
98366303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d5669151876d0bca9bdc55b83a4828b12b024d OP_EQUAL
address
MUwhHtVbMu5R68MB89oLafi2Srq5jWVXD1
transaction
83c24de6b1f146ae414677ff2df51aaa4fed4e83a1e982d320f6aa942a18f8ee
spent
true